2. Choosing the Perfect Color Palette
A well-chosen color palette sets the foundation for a luxurious interior. Opt for rich, warm tones like deep burgundy, regal purple, or royal blue to create an atmosphere of elegance. Alternatively, neutral shades such as ivory, cream, or taupe can provide a sophisticated backdrop that allows other design elements to shine. Consider accent colors like gold, silver, or emerald green to add a touch of glamour and opulence.

4. Elegant Flooring and Wall Treatments
Luxury interior design extends to the flooring and walls. Consider luxurious options such as marble or hardwood flooring, which exude sophistication and durability. For wall treatments, decorative moldings, textured wallpapers, or intricate paneling can add a touch of architectural elegance. Experiment with wallpaper patterns, metallic accents, or unique finishes to create a sense of luxury and visual interest.
5. Illuminating with Luxury Lighting
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ood and enhancing the overall ambiance. Opt for elegant chandeliers, sconces, or pendant lights to add a touch of grandeur to your living spaces. Consider accent lighting to highlight artwork, architectural features, or focal points. Dimmer switches can offer flexibility, allowing you to create different atmospheres for various occasions.

9. Designing Luxurious Bathrooms
Bathrooms offer an opportunity to indulge in lavishness and create a spa-like retreat. Install luxurious fixtures, such as rainfall showerheads, freestanding bathtubs, and elegant vanity units. Consider adding underfloor heating, ambient lighting, and smart features for added convenience. Pay attention to details like high-quality towels, plush bathrobes, and scented candles to elevate the sense of luxury.
10. The Heart of the Home: Lavish Kitchens
Luxury kitchens blend functionality with aesthetics seamlessly. Choose high-end appliances, custom cabinetry, and exquisite countertop materials like granite or marble. Incorporate statement lighting fixtures, such as pendant lights above the kitchen island. Consider adding a wine cellar, a spacious pantry, or a coffee bar to enhance the functionality and create a luxurious culinary haven.

13. Incorporating Technology Seamlessly
Embrace smart home technology to elevate your luxury living experience. Install automated systems for lighting, temperature control, and entertainment. Integrate audio-visual systems discreetly into the design, ensuring they blend seamlessly with the overall aesthetic. Conceal wires and devices to maintain a clean and uncluttered look while enjoying the convenience and comfort of modern technology.
